Correction: Illinois Shootings-Vigil story

CHAMPAIGN, Ill. (AP) - In a story Sept. 27 about a vigil at the University of Illinois for several shooting victims, The Associated Press misspelled the name of a man who was killed. He was George Korchev, not George Korchef.

A corrected version of the story is below:

Vigil held for victims of U of I shootings that left 1 dead

CHAMPAIGN, Ill. (AP) - Hundreds of people gathered by candlelight on the campus of the University of Illinois in Champaign to remember victims of a shooting that left one dead.

One of those speaking during the vigil Tuesday evening was Erik Lasaine, a student who was shot in the back during Sunday morning's shootings. Others attending the vigil noted the fear that spread across the campus.

Twenty-two-year-old George Korchev of Mundelein was in town visiting Lasaine when he was fatally shot as they walked down the street.

WGN-TV reports Korchev was a recent nursing graduate who would have started a new job Monday.

Police say two others were wounded during the shooting outside a party were a dispute broke out. None of the four victims was part of the disagreement or attended the party.
